UNPKG

visreg-test

Version:

A visual regression testing solution that offers an easy setup with simple yet powerful customisation options, wrapped up in a convenient CLI runner to make assessing and accepting/rejecting diffs a breeze.

26 lines (25 loc) 889 B
#!/usr/bin/env node import { ConfigurationSettings, ProgramChoices } from './types'; export type SummaryObject = { tests?: number; passing?: number; failing?: number; pending?: number; skipped?: number; duration?: number; }; export type EndpointTestResult = { testTitle: string; errorMessage?: string; endpointTitle: string; viewport: string; }; export type EndpointTestResultsGroup = { passing: EndpointTestResult[]; failing: EndpointTestResult[]; skipped: EndpointTestResult[]; unchanged: EndpointTestResult[]; }; export declare const getVersion: () => any; export declare const getDiffsForWeb: (suiteSlug: string, conf?: ConfigurationSettings) => import("./diff-assessment-web").DiffObject[]; export declare const startWebTest: (ws: WebSocket, progChoices: Partial<ProgramChoices>, conf?: ConfigurationSettings) => Promise<void>;